Abstract: A configuration for a laser fuse bank is disclosed wherein the available space is more efficiently used. Fuses (101, 102, 103) of graduated width and variable configuration are placed so as to minimize the average distance between fuses and maximize fuse density. Alternatively, a common source is added to a standard laser fuse structure such that it intersects the fuses and the number of available fuses is doubled.
